Today's episode is about source citations. We'll discuss when you need to make citations, how to do it, and the questions to ask that will guide you as you create them: who, what, when, where within, and where in the world. If you feel overwhelmed by the thought of making source citations you're not alone. Nicole tells about her experience really learning how to do it.  Diana will tell us about layered source citations, and we'll also talk about the difference between reference notes and source list entries.
